Drain your air compressor by shutting it off, depressurizing the tank, and opening the bottom drain valve until condensation stops and only air escapes.

An air compressor tank collects water every time it runs. That moisture rusts the tank from the inside and shortens its life. The fix takes about a minute, and doing it on a regular schedule keeps the tank sound. Whether you use a pancake unit in the garage or a large stationary model in a workshop, the same basic procedure applies.
Why Draining the Tank Matters
Compressed air gets hot, and as it cools inside the tank, humidity condenses into liquid water. Left sitting, that water corrodes steel and can eventually compromise the tank’s integrity. The condensate also carries rust flakes, oil, and debris, which is why the discharge can look dirty.
CP Compressors notes that regular draining is a core part of air-treatment maintenance, and most manufacturers list tank draining as a routine task in their manuals. Skipping it is the fastest way to shorten the life of a compressor that otherwise runs for years.
How to Drain Your Compressor Tank Safely
The drain valve sits at the lowest point of the tank — often a petcock, a screw valve, or an automatic drain. Here is the safe sequence that works for most manual-drain models:
- Turn off and unplug the compressor. Cut power at the switch first, then pull the plug.
- Depressurize the tank. Pull the safety relief valve or run a tool briefly to bleed the pressure down to a safe level. Never open the drain valve on a fully pressurized tank unless the manual specifically allows it.
- Position a container. Place a pan, bucket, or hose under the drain to control the discharge.
- Open the valve slowly. Turn it just enough to start flow, and let the condensate drain completely.
- Close the valve. Once only air comes out, close the valve firmly — but don’t overtighten it.
Wear eye protection during this step. The condensate can spray rust flakes and oil, and you don’t want that in your eyes. Check for leaks after closing by listening for hissing around the valve.
When a Different Drain Procedure Applies
Not every compressor drains the same way. Larger systems often use an automatic drain valve that purges condensate on a timer or when a level sensor triggers — these operate without depressurizing the system, and you should follow the manufacturer’s service instructions instead of the manual-tank procedure.
If your compressor has a threaded drain fitting instead of a petcock, the principle is the same: open it slowly, let the water out, and close it snugly. Don’t leave a manual valve open after refilling the tank; a partially open valve bleeds air and can slow the next cycle significantly.
For a unit that runs daily, drain the tank at the end of each session. For weekend use, once a month is usually enough. A quick habit beats a tank replacement every time.
FAQs
How often should I drain my air compressor?
Drain the tank after every use if you run the compressor daily, or at least once a month for occasional use. More frequent draining is better in humid climates, where condensation forms faster. The goal is to keep standing water out of the tank so rust never gets a start.
What happens if I don’t drain the compressor?
Moisture sits at the bottom of the tank and corrodes the steel from the inside. Over time, this rust can create weak spots and shorten the tank’s lifespan. The condensate can also carry debris into the air lines and ruin downstream tools or finishes that need dry air.
Can I drain the tank while it’s still pressurized?
Only if the manufacturer’s manual explicitly says so. On most portable models, the drain valve is not built for high-pressure discharge, and opening it while fully pressurized can blast condensate and debris out violently. Depressurize by pulling the safety relief valve, then drain.
